x86/mce: Use arch atomic and bit helpers



The arch helpers do not have explicit KASAN instrumentation. Use them in
noinstr code.

Inline a couple more functions with single call sites, while at it:

mce_severity_amd_smca() has a single call-site which is noinstr so force
the inlining and fix:

  vmlinux.o: warning: objtool: mce_severity_amd.constprop.0()+0xca: call to \
	  mce_severity_amd_smca() leaves .noinstr.text section

Always inline mca_msr_reg():

     text    data     bss     dec     hex filename
  16065240        128031326       36405368        180501934       ac23dae vmlinux.before
  16065240        128031294       36405368        180501902       ac23d8e vmlinux.after

and mce_no_way_out() as the latter one is used only once, to fix:

  vmlinux.o: warning: objtool: mce_read_aux()+0x53: call to mca_msr_reg() leaves .noinstr.text section
  vmlinux.o: warning: objtool: do_machine_check()+0xc9: call to mce_no_way_out() leaves .noinstr.text section
